Espag
Espag is handles that is placed on uPVC windows and doors. These are handles that are turned to operate a multi-point locking system that locks the uPVC or casement window made of timber when it is opened. These handles are also found on French Doors as well as other types of window frames. These handles are the most secure for double-glazed windows because they come with multiple locks that turn when it is being used.
The handles feature a metal spindle on the back that fits into a gearbox in the window to operate a set of multi-point locks located on the outside of the window. They can come in the form of roller cams, shootbolts or dead bolts or a combination of both. This makes them perfect for uPVC or aluminium windows. They are available in both cranked and straight models, based on the way your windows are made.

If you're looking to replace your current uPVC window handle or are installing new uPVC windows, it is worth understanding the differences between cockspur and espag handles to ensure you get the right replacement for your windows. Cockspur handles are typically used on older double-glazed windows. Espag handles are more popular in modern homes that have uPVC window styles.
The espag mechanism is different from the cockspur mechanism as it uses a flat metal strip (called an espagnolette rod) that runs up the side of the window that locks. The handle for the espagnolette is equipped with round studs, referred to as mushrooms, that move upwards and down when the espagnolette rod is moved. The mushrooms are then stowed in a metal plate referred to as a keep, which is placed on the window frame.

When the window is closed it is secured and locked. When the handle is positioned vertically up, the sash is tilted inward approximately 20 degrees. This is an efficient and comfortable method of allowing air to circulate because air circulates through the top gap.
To turn the window handle, rotate it until it is 90 degrees to lock position. The sash will open inwards and be secured by hinges at the bottom. This allows the windows to be opened further, allowing more air circulation and light.
